AI Contract Overview
The Engineering Standards Technical Update is a subcontract for the City of Redwood City in California, focused on the technical revision of City Engineering Standards for prime contractors. The selected provider will review and update technical engineering specifications to ensure full consistency with current city policies and state requirements. A critical requirement for this engagement is that the performing party must hold a Professional Engineering (PE) license. The primary deliverables for this project include a fully revised Engineering Standards document and the preparation of a technical resolution to be submitted for City Council approval. This work falls under NAICS code 541330 and is centered on maintaining high-quality technical standards for city infrastructure projects.
